Almond Peanut Butter Squares

 Almond Peanut Butter


Squares are delicious no-bake treats that offer a delightful combination of nutty flavors and textures. They're perfect for satisfying your sweet tooth and are relatively simple to make at home. Here's a basic recipe to get you started:

Ingredients:

  • Base:

    • 1 cup rolled oats
    • ¾ cup almond flour (or all-purpose flour)
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• Peanut Butter Layer:

    • ½ cup creamy peanut butter
    • ¼ cup honey (or maple syrup)
    • 1 tablespoon melted coconut oil (or unsalted butter)
    •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Top Layer:

    • ½ cup melted semisweet chocolate chips
    • ¼ cup chopped almonds (optional)

Instructions:

  1. Preparing the Base: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) if you choose to toast the oats (optional). In a medium bowl, combine the rolled oats, almond flour (or all-purpose flour), and salt. If toasting the oats, spread them on a baking sheet and bake for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until lightly golden brown. Remove from the oven and let cool slightly before using.

  2. Making the Peanut Butter Layer: In a separate bowl, cream together the peanut butter, honey (or maple syrup), melted coconut oil (or butter), and vanilla extract until smooth and well combined.

  3. Assembling the Bars: Line an 8x8 inch baking pan with parchment paper. Press the oat mixture evenly into the bottom of the prepared pan. This will form the base of the bars.

  4. Adding the Peanut Butter Layer: Pour the peanut butter mixture over the oat base and spread it into an even layer.

  5. Chocolate Topping (Optional): Melt the semisweet chocolate chips in a microwave-safe bowl using short bursts with stirring, or over a double boiler. Once melted and smooth, pour the chocolate over the peanut butter layer.

  6. Adding Almonds (Optional): Sprinkle the chopped almonds over the melted chocolate for an extra nutty crunch (optional).

  7. Refrigerate and Cut: Refrigerate the bars for at least 2 hours, or until the chocolate layer is firm. This allows the bars to set properly. Cut the bars into squares for serving.

Tips:

  • Use high-quality peanut butter for the best flavor.
  • If the peanut butter mixture feels too thick and difficult to spread, add a tablespoon or two of milk to achieve a desired consistency.
  • You can get creative with the toppings! Consider chopped dried fruit, shredded coconut, or even a drizzle of caramel sauce.
  • These bars can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week.
